## Deployment

Ledgerlark converts all amounts through its base currency before settlement, and rounding mode matters: banker's rounding is applied at the minor-unit boundary, never earlier. If you deploy with mismatched precision settings between the converter and the settlement worker, sub-cent residues accumulate and the nightly reconciliation in Fernwick will page you. Always verify that both services share identical rounding and precision values before promoting a build. The exact values the production cluster expects are listed below.

deployment values, yadug-bawif:
[framir]
team = pelox
access_code = ac_a38ab2
owner = tamion.julael
host = framir.tolvaqlabs.test
port = 11211
peer = tammir.zemvargrid.local
salt = 2215ef03
pin = 1541

# Catalogue Import: Limits & Quotas

Welcome aboard! The Shelfwright importer is pretty forgiving, but it will throttle you if you push too many MARC batches at once. Nightly runs from the Bramblehurst branch get priority, so schedule contractor jobs for afternoons. Don't hand-edit these without pinging the data team first. Current quota constants are as follows.

tuning table, yajog-yahof:
BUDGETS = {
    "lamvan": 303,
    "wenox": 460,
    "fenvan": 525,
}

Handover: the Tillgate payments integration suite is flaky on the refund-reconciliation path — roughly one in eight runs times out waiting on the mock ledger. I've quarantined the three worst tests and filed follow-ups. Nothing blocks the release train, but please track the quarantine list. Questions on the fix plan should go to the owner below.

account owner for fajep-yagef: Kasix Eliiel

Hey Priya — handing over the Quillbase static-analysis setup. Heads up: the baseline file (`sa-baseline.yml`) suppresses about 140 legacy findings so new PRs stay clean. Don't let anyone add fresh suppressions without a ticket — that's the whole game. I've been burning down roughly ten entries a sprint. The suppression policy and the burn-down tracker are on the page below.

runbook for fajep-yahop: https://rundeck.braskdata.example/repo/run/pages/job/dfe5b8c563356906